Which of the following numbers is equivalent to √-200?

a. 10√2
b. -10i√2
c. -10√2
d. 10i√2

Answer:

D

Step-by-step explanation:

The i indicates the square root of - 1.

B or D are  the only possible answers. But which one is it? You have to split the numbers apart.

sqrt(-1) * sqrt(200)

i * 10*sqrt(2)

D

The other three are simply incorrect.
